Given that,
Mass of the car, m = 710 kg
Speed of the car, v = 23 m/s
Drag force, F = 500 N
(a) Let P is the power is required from the car's engine to drive the car on the level ground. Power is given by :
[tex]P=F\times v\\\\P=500\ N\times 23\ m/s\\\\P=11500\ W[/tex]
(b) Let P is the power is required from the car's engine to drive the car on up a hill with a slope of 2 degrees.
At this slope, force will be, [tex]F=mg\ \sin\theta[/tex]
Total force will be :
[tex]F=710\times 9.8\times \sin(2)+500\\F=742.83\ N[/tex]
Power is given by :
[tex]P=F\times v\\\\P=742.83\times 23\\\\P=17085.09\ W[/tex]
or
P = 17 kW
